Among the common industrial uses of ethanol are:
Ethanol Absolute Alcohol 99,9% is used as a solvent, in homeopathy extraction of active herbal ingredients, manufacture of perfumes and other products such as sanitiser.

c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, tools, and electronics; acting as a solvent in industries like paint and cosmetics; serving as an ingredient in hand sanitizers and other personal care products; functioning as a fuelfor stoves and camping equipment; and aiding in the preservation of biological specimens. It is also used in pest control, and to create inks and dyes.
- Cleaning & Disinfecting: Effective for c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, medical instruments, and electronic components because it evaporates quickly without leaving residue.
- Solvent: Dissolves a wide range of organic compounds, oils, resins, and waxes, making it useful in the manufacturing of cosmetics, perfumes, paints, coatings, and adhesives.
- Personal Care: A key ingredient in hand sanitizers, cosmetics, and other personal care products.
- Fuel: Serves as a clean-burning fuel for portable stoves, camping stoves, and heaters.
- Crafts & Hobbies: Used as a solvent for shellac in woodworking and to prepare inks and dyes for artistic projects.
- Pesticides: Functions as a solvent and carrier in pesticide formulations, aiding in the distribution and penetration of active ingredients.
- Extraction: Utilized as an extraction solvent for active herbal ingredients in the pharmaceutical and homeopathy industries.
- Manufacturing: Serves as an extraction solvent in the production of other chemicals, such as synthetic acetic acid and ether-derived products.
- Biofuel: Blended with gasoline to create biofuel for automobiles.
- Mold & Mildew Control: Can be used in equal parts with water to eliminate mold and mildew from surfaces.

Properties
| grade | for gradient elution |
| vapor density | 1.59 (vs air) |
| vapor pressure | 44.6 mmHg ( 20 °C) |
| grade | absolute |
| assay | 99.9% |
| autoignition temp. | 683 °F |
| expl. lim. | 19 %, 60 °F |
| impurities | ≤0.0005% free alkali (as NH3) |
| ≤0.001% free acid (as CH3COOH) | |
| ≤0.001% non-volatile matter | |
| ≤0.1% water (Karl Fischer) | |
| ≤1 ppb fluorescence (quinine) 254 nm | |
| ≤1 ppb fluorescence (quinine) 365 nm | |
| transmittance | 210 nm, ≥25% |
| 225 nm, ≥65% | |
| 240 nm, ≥85% | |
| 260 nm, ≥98% | |
| refractive index | n20/D 1.3600 (lit.) |
| bp | 78 °C (lit.) |
| mp | −114 °C (lit.) |
| density | 0.789 g/mL at 25 °C (lit.) |
| HPLC-gradient | ≤2 mAU at 254 nm |
| ≤5 mAU at 235 nm | |
| suitability | passes test for IR spectroscopy |
| passes test for suitability for UV spectroscopy | |
| SMILES string | CCO |
| InChI | 1S/C2H6O/c1-2-3/h3H,2H2,1 |
| InChI key | LFQSCWFLJHTTHZ-UHFFFAOYSA |
